Biography

Bilgore graduated with a degree in Theatre from Dartmouth College, marking the beginning of his esteemed theatre career. His early journey included training at the National Theater Institute at the Eugene O'Neill Theater Center, where renowned Group Theater founding member Morris Carnovsky affectionately nicknamed him "The Voice!" This prestigious training experience was followed by his selection by the esteemed Sir Ralph Richardson to perform in a summer season with the National Youth Theatre of Great Britain at the Shaw Theatre in London.

Subsequent to his London stint, Bilgore pursued graduate training at the esteemed Guildhall School of Music & Drama in London. His exceptional talent and dedication earned him the admiration of legendary Royal Shakespeare Company director Sir Trevor Nunn, who praised him, saying, "He is what I understand to be an actor; he is detailed, he is truthful, he is insightful, he is original, he is multiple."

After relocating to Los Angeles, Bilgore received critical acclaim and a "Best Ensemble" Dramalogue Award for his performance as "J.J." opposite Patricia Heaton in her stage production of The Johnstown Vindicator. He then went on to star alongside notable actors, including Bob Newhart in the CBS series BOB, Steve Harvey in the ABC series Me & the Boys, Shelley Long and Robert Hayes in Kelly Kelly for the WB, and made guest appearances on numerous top shows.

One of his most notable roles was as "Wayne", the delusional robot creator, in the fan-favorite "Mac & C.H.E.E.S.E" storyline on Friends. Prolific TV and Oscar-nominated producer Michael Jacobs, known for Quiz Show, cast him in two of his shows and praised him as "the best deadpan in town!" Jeff Nathanson, writer of Catch Me If You Can, created the role of "Kilgore" specifically for Bilgore in his Fox pilot, The 900 Lives of Jackie Frye.

Furthermore, Kathleen Turner proclaimed that Bilgore's portrayal of "Walt" was her favorite in her ABC pilot, Style & Substance. Additionally, Paul Simms, creator of News Radio and executive producer of Girls, alongside legendary comedy director James Burrows, selected Bilgore to star as the bumbling science teacher, "Peterson", for their ABC pilot Dexter Prep.
